Which of the following best describes the ordered pairs listed below? Dont answer it for me just tell me how to tell if it's a function or relation or both or neither 2, -2), (0, -4), (4, -8), (8, -12) A. both a relation and a function B. function only C. relation only D. neither a relation nor a function
A function is a (x,y) value. In order to be a function the "x" value CAN'T repeat, but it doesn't matter if the "y" value repeats
For example: (4,5) , (6,1) , (2,7). That's a function because the "x" value does not repeat. The "x" value is, the first number. In this case it's 4,6,2
A relation is a set of numbers, or pairs. There is nothing special about the numbers that are in a relation. its just a set of ordered pairs. {} is the symbol for "Set". An example: {(0,1) , (55,22) , (3, -50)}
